Que. Which of the following is not a recognised causes of macrocytosis in the peripheral blood with normoblastic erythropoiesis in the bone marrow:
A. Cryptogenic cirrhosis
B. The administration of phenytoin
C. Chronic alcohol abuse
D. Hypothyroidism
Ans. B
A number of drugs antagonize folate by mechanisms which are poorly understood but are thought to involve an effect on absorption of the vitamin by the intestine. In this category are the anticonvulsants phenytoin (Dilantin) and primidone (Mysoline) and phenobarbital (Luminal). Megaloblastic anemia induced by these agents is mild.
